Pittsburgh Pirates @ San Francisco Giants

Pittsburgh Pirates21-18 (10-9 away)
Final 13 - 3
San Francisco Giants15-23 (9-11 home)
1.94BetOnline.ag ML 1.96BetOnline.ag
-1 (2.15)ReBet Spread +1.5 (1.54)BetOnline.ag
O 7 (1.83)Bally Bet O/U U 7.5 (1.81)DraftKings

Team Stats

Pittsburgh Pirates
San Francisco Giants
21-18 Record 15-23
L1 Streak W1
4.8 Offence 3.2
4.2 Defence 4.2
9.0 Total 7.3
+0.6 Margin -1.0
21-17-1 Spread 18-20
L1 ATS Streak W1
20-18-1 O/U 16-20-2
U3 O/U Streak U2
Pittsburgh Pirates
San Francisco Giants
10-9 Record 9-11
L1 Streak W1
3.7 Offence 3.2
3.9 Defence 4.1
7.6 Total 7.3
-0.3 Margin -0.9
10-8-1 Spread 9-11
L1 ATS Streak W1
7-11-1 O/U 8-10-2
U3 O/U Streak U2
Pittsburgh Pirates
San Francisco Giants
0-1 Record 1-0
L1 Streak W1
2.0 Offence 5.0
5.0 Defence 2.0
7.0 Total 7.0
-3.0 Margin +3.0
0-1 Spread 1-0
L1 ATS Streak W1
0-1 O/U 0-1
U1 O/U Streak U1

Team Schedule

Date Opponent Result ML Spread O/U
May 8, '26 @ San Francisco Giants L 2-5 L 2.04 L +1.5 U 7.5
May 7, '26 @ Arizona Diamondbacks W 4-2 W 2.00 W +1.5 U 8.5
May 6, '26 @ Arizona Diamondbacks W 1-0 W 1.84 P -1 U 7.5
May 5, '26 @ Arizona Diamondbacks L 0-9 L 2.18 L +1.5 P 9
May 3, '26 Cincinnati Reds W 1-0 W 1.85 W +1.5 U 7.5
May 2, '26 Cincinnati Reds W 17-7 W 1.75 W -1 O 8
May 1, '26 Cincinnati Reds W 9-1 W 1.78 W -1.5 O 8
Apr 30, '26 St. Louis Cardinals L 5-10 L 1.44 L -1.5 O 7
Apr 29, '26 St. Louis Cardinals L 4-5 L 1.80 L -1 O 8.5
Apr 28, '26 St. Louis Cardinals L 7-11 L 1.65 L -1 O 8
Date Opponent Result ML Spread O/U
May 8, '26 Pittsburgh Pirates W 5-2 W 1.93 W +1.5 U 7.5
May 6, '26 San Diego Padres L 1-5 L 1.92 L +1.5 U 8.5
May 5, '26 San Diego Padres L 5-10 L 1.71 L -1.5 O 7.5
May 4, '26 San Diego Padres W 3-2 W 2.17 W +1.5 U 8
May 3, '26 @ Tampa Bay Rays L 1-2 L 2.07 W +1.5 U 8
May 2, '26 @ Tampa Bay Rays L 1-5 L 1.92 L -1 U 7.5
May 1, '26 @ Tampa Bay Rays L 0-3 L 2.20 L +1.5 U 7.5
Apr 30, '26 @ Philadelphia Phillies L 5-6 L 2.23 W +1.5 O 8
Apr 30, '26 @ Philadelphia Phillies L 2-3 L 2.40 W +1.5 U 7
Apr 28, '26 @ Philadelphia Phillies L 0-7 L 2.40 L +1.5 U 8
Date Home Result ML Spread O/U
May 8, '26 5-2 1.93 +1.5 U 7.5

Best Lines/Odds

Pittsburgh Pirates San Francisco Giants
BestClosing 1.94-0.01BetOnline.ag 1.96-0.01BetOnline.ag
BestOpening 1.95BetUS 1.97BetOnline.ag
Pittsburgh Pirates San Francisco Giants
BestClosing -1(2.15+0.02)ReBet +1.5(1.54-0.03)BetOnline.ag
BestOpening -1(2.13)ReBet +1.5(1.57)Bovada
Over Under
BestClosing O 7(1.83-0.17)Bally Bet U 7.5(1.81-0.14)DraftKings
BestOpening O 7(2.00)Caesars U 7.5(1.95)Fanatics

Odds History

Book Best Odds
Bally Bet Pittsburgh Pirates 1.92+0.01
San Francisco Giants 1.89-0.02
BetMGM Pittsburgh Pirates 1.91
San Francisco Giants 1.91
BetOnline.ag Pittsburgh Pirates 1.94+0.01
San Francisco Giants 1.96-0.01
BetRivers Pittsburgh Pirates 1.91
San Francisco Giants 1.88-0.01
BetUS Pittsburgh Pirates 1.94-0.01
San Francisco Giants 1.96+0.01
Bovada Pittsburgh Pirates 1.91+0.04
San Francisco Giants 1.91-0.04
Caesars Pittsburgh Pirates 1.91+0.04
San Francisco Giants 1.91-0.04
DraftKings Pittsburgh Pirates 1.91+0.02
San Francisco Giants 1.91-0.02
Fanatics Pittsburgh Pirates 1.91+0.04
San Francisco Giants 1.91-0.04
FanDuel Pittsburgh Pirates 1.91+0.02
San Francisco Giants 1.94-0.02
LowVig.ag Pittsburgh Pirates 1.94+0.01
San Francisco Giants 1.96-0.01
MyBookie.ag Pittsburgh Pirates 1.92+0.02
San Francisco Giants 1.93-0.01
ReBet Pittsburgh Pirates 1.91+0.08
San Francisco Giants 1.91+0.04
theScore Bet Pittsburgh Pirates 1.87
San Francisco Giants 1.95
Book Best Odds
Bally Bet Pittsburgh Pirates -1.5(2.60+0.10)
San Francisco Giants +1.5(1.50-0.01)
BetMGM Pittsburgh Pirates -1.5(2.54-0.01)
San Francisco Giants +1.5(1.53)
BetOnline.ag Pittsburgh Pirates -1.5(2.61+0.04)
San Francisco Giants +1.5(1.54-0.02)
BetRivers Pittsburgh Pirates -1.5(2.60+0.10)
San Francisco Giants +1.5(1.50-0.01)
BetUS Pittsburgh Pirates -1.5(2.60+0.04)
San Francisco Giants +1.5(1.54-0.02)
Bovada Pittsburgh Pirates -1.5(2.60+0.10)
San Francisco Giants +1.5(1.54-0.03)
Caesars Pittsburgh Pirates -1.5(2.58+0.08)
San Francisco Giants +1.5(1.53-0.03)
DraftKings Pittsburgh Pirates -1.5(2.59+0.06)
San Francisco Giants +1.5(1.52-0.02)
Fanatics Pittsburgh Pirates -1.5(2.55+0.05)
San Francisco Giants +1.5(1.53-0.03)
FanDuel Pittsburgh Pirates -1.5(2.58+0.08)
San Francisco Giants +1.5(1.52-0.03)
LowVig.ag Pittsburgh Pirates -1.5(2.62+0.04)
San Francisco Giants +1.5(1.54-0.02)
MyBookie.ag Pittsburgh Pirates -1.5(2.55+0.05)
San Francisco Giants +1.5(1.53-0.03)
ReBet Pittsburgh Pirates -1(2.15+0.02)
San Francisco Giants +1(1.65-0.02)
theScore Bet Pittsburgh Pirates -1.5(2.60)
San Francisco Giants +1.5(1.53)
Book Best Odds
Bally Bet Over O 7-0.5(1.83-0.05)
Under U 7-0.5(2.00+0.09)
BetMGM Over O 7-0.5(1.80-0.11)
Under U 7-0.5(2.05+0.14)
BetOnline.ag Over O 7-0.5(1.80-0.15)
Under U 7-0.5(2.05+0.18)
BetRivers Over O 7-0.5(1.82-0.06)
Under U 7-0.5(1.97+0.06)
BetUS Over O 7-0.5(1.80-0.11)
Under U 7-0.5(2.05+0.14)
Bovada Over O 7-0.5(1.83-0.08)
Under U 7-0.5(2.00+0.09)
Caesars Over O 7(1.80-0.20)
Under U 7(2.05+0.22)
DraftKings Over O 7.5+0.5(2.02+0.04)
Under U 7.5+0.5(1.81-0.04)
Fanatics Over O 7.5(2.05+0.18)
Under U 7.5(1.80-0.15)
FanDuel Over O 7-0.5(1.82-0.05)
Under U 7-0.5(2.00+0.05)
LowVig.ag Over O 7-0.5(1.81-0.17)
Under U 7-0.5(2.07+0.19)
MyBookie.ag Over O 7-0.5(1.80-0.12)
Under U 7-0.5(2.02+0.13)
ReBet Over O 7-0.5(1.80-0.04)
Under U 7-0.5(2.00+0.14)
theScore Bet Over O 7.5(2.05+0.18)
Under U 7.5(1.80-0.15)

Game Results by Top Cappers

Capper Profit Results
#1 inplaybeast +7.65
Pittsburgh Pirates -1.5@ 2.53for 5 unitsWon +7.65
#2 pickemhawk +6.40
Pittsburgh Pirates -1.5@ 2.60for 4 unitsWon +6.40
#3 steamscout +6.40
Pittsburgh Pirates -1.5@ 2.60for 4 unitsWon +6.40
#4 highrollerbaron +6.20
Pittsburgh Pirates -1.5@ 2.55for 4 unitsWon +6.20
#5 hoopbeast +5.60
Pittsburgh Pirates -1.5@ 2.40for 4 unitsWon +5.60
#6 cardgambler +4.80
Pittsburgh Pirates -1.5@ 2.60for 3 unitsWon +4.80
#7 trixiegambler +4.75
Over 7.5@ 1.95for 5 unitsWon +4.75
#8 bookiecontrarian +4.65
Over 7.5@ 1.93for 5 unitsWon +4.65
#9 atsbandit +4.55
Over 7.5@ 1.91for 5 unitsWon +4.55
#10 atsbaron +4.55
Over 7.5@ 1.91for 5 unitsWon +4.55
#11 hoopbroker +4.55
Over 7.5@ 1.91for 5 unitsWon +4.55
#12 nflgrinder +4.55
Over 7.5@ 1.91for 5 unitsWon +4.55
#13 vigorishshark +4.52
Pittsburgh Pirates -1@ 2.13for 4 unitsWon +4.52
#14 futureshunter +4.50
Pittsburgh Pirates -1.5@ 2.50for 3 unitsWon +4.50
#15 inplaygrinder +4.44
Pittsburgh Pirates -1.5@ 2.48for 3 unitsWon +4.44
#16 asianplays +4.35
Pittsburgh Pirates -1.5@ 2.45for 3 unitsWon +4.35
#17 edgescout +3.48
Pittsburgh Pirates@ 1.87for 4 unitsWon +3.48
#18 futuresmvp +3.32
Pittsburgh Pirates@ 1.83for 4 unitsWon +3.32
#19 actionwizard +3.24
Pittsburgh Pirates -1.5@ 2.62for 2 unitsWon +3.24
#20 cardhawk +3.00
Over 7.5@ 2.00for 3 unitsWon +3.00

Game Consensus

42 picks | 74 units
Pittsburgh Pirates
San Francisco Giants
23 picks | 55%
19 picks | 45%
43 units | 58%
31 units | 42%
Picks Per Odds Range
Pittsburgh Pirates
Picks
San Francisco Giants
1.83 - 1.92
23
19
1.89 - 2.00
51 picks | 101 units
Pittsburgh Pirates
San Francisco Giants
25 picks | 49%
26 picks | 51%
54 units | 53%
47 units | 47%
Picks Per Line
Pittsburgh Pirates
Picks
San Francisco Giants
-1
1
1
+1
-1.5
24
25
+1.5
59 picks | 124 units
Over
Under
31 picks | 53%
28 picks | 47%
70 units | 56%
54 units | 44%
Picks Per Line
Over
Picks
Under
O 7
12
8
U 7
O 7.5
19
20
U 7.5

Moneyline

Trends for best moneyline odds.

Pittsburgh Pirates (1.94)

  • Pittsburgh Pirates won as away favorite in 5 of 5 (100%) Favorite split - Away
  • Pittsburgh Pirates won as favorite in 15 of 23 (65%) Favorite split
  • San Francisco Giants lost as underdog in 15 of 24 (63%) Underdog split
  • San Francisco Giants lost 23 of 38 (61%) Season
  • San Francisco Giants lost as home underdog in 7 of 13 (54%) Underdog split - Home
  • San Francisco Giants lost at home in 11 of 20 (55%) Season - Home
  • Pittsburgh Pirates won 21 of 39 (54%) Season
  • Pittsburgh Pirates won on the road in 10 of 19 (53%) Season - Away

San Francisco Giants (1.96)

No trends.

Spread

Trends for best spread lines.

Pittsburgh Pirates -1

  • Pittsburgh Pirates covered as away favorite in 5 of 7 (71%) Favorite ATS split - Away
  • Pittsburgh Pirates covered as favorite in 13 of 23 (57%) Favorite ATS split
  • San Francisco Giants failed to cover +1 at home in 11 of 20 (55%) Season at current line - Home
  • San Francisco Giants failed to cover as home underdog in 9 of 17 (53%) Underdog ATS split - Home

San Francisco Giants +1.5

  • Pittsburgh Pirates failed to cover -1.5 on the road in 12 of 19 (63%) Season at current line - Away
  • Pittsburgh Pirates failed to cover -1.5 in 24 of 39 (62%) Season at current line

Total

Trends for best over/under lines.

Over 7

  • Pittsburgh Pirates played over 7 in 21 of 35 (60%) Season at current total
  • Both teams played over 7 in 38 of 69 (55%) Season at current total - Both teams

Under 7.5

  • Pittsburgh Pirates played under 7.5 on the road in 12 of 19 (63%) Season at current total
  • San Francisco Giants played under 7.5 at home in 12 of 20 (60%) Season at current total
  • Pittsburgh Pirates played under 7.5 in 3 straight Streak
  • Pittsburgh Pirates played under 7.5 in 3 straight on the road Streak - Away
  • San Francisco Giants played under 7.5 in 21 of 38 (55%) Season at current total
  • San Francisco Giants played under 7.5 in 2 straight Streak
  • San Francisco Giants played under 7.5 in 2 straight at home Streak - Home
  • Both teams played under 7.5 in 39 of 77 (51%) Season at current total - Both teams